Cellnext service to Star channels

Our Bureau

NEW DELHI: Cellnext Solutions Ltd, an Escorts group company, will provide SMS service for all Star channels.

Through the service, viewers would be able to participate in shows/contests, astrology, song requests, bidding on the various television and radio channels.

Mr Atanu Mandal, CEO, Cellnext Solutions, said that such SMS interactivity made possible by Cellnext will foster instant interaction between Star and its viewers through various mobile operators' networks. Mr Sameer Nair, CEO, Star Group, said, ``With more and more TV programming turning to interactive mode, making our bouquet accessible on cellphones is one step towards Star's concern for its discerning viewers. This technology is designed to bring viewers close to the channel.''
